The time to prepare your dog for the holiday season is... NOW! In this episode, I'll break down 3 tips to help you start preparing now so that you can have an enjoyable season of get-togethers.
TIP #1- Teach Place
This behavior is vital to overcoming challenges with door greetings, being hyper when guests arrive, and of course, begging for food.

TIP #2- Impulse Control Training
Impulse control training can help with problems like jumping, barking, bolting through doors, and so much more.
Simple impulse control exercises like having your dog sit before going through doors can help teach your dog to look for guidance from you instead of just acting on their own.

TIP #3- Get the Right Tools
Sometimes even with the right training you just need a 'safety net' of tools and products to help keep your pup occupied and happy.
Mental enrichment can work wonders for your dog during the holiday season. Whether you're leaving your pup at home or having guests over, mental exercise can help tire your dog out and help them relax.
